1)oki Since KOH is a strong base it will ionize completely :yep:


2) Equation : KOH (aq)-----> K+(aq) + OH-(aq) :biggrin:


pH+pOH=14

pOH=14-11.90=2.1

[OH-]=10^-pOH

= 10^-2.1=7.9 EXP -3
